Output 90d34b22a83033b8fe35cdc56e1ffe4a26c8f2461678d0e532a3fa256c3703cb:1

value
8021509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f4c487f727a3745b02370fdcfcf6904fcc9b062 OP_EQUAL
address
3GDJkJ1XeHRMb5yfpQXjFwbtyHnt9prpFn
transaction
90d34b22a83033b8fe35cdc56e1ffe4a26c8f2461678d0e532a3fa256c3703cb
confirmations
96
spent
true